BlueSteps:

For access: click here

"BlueSteps is a subscription membership service for your career. We support senior executives with job search, career mapping and navigating executive search. A service of the Association of Executive Search and Leadership Consultants, BlueSteps empowers director-level through C-Suite professionals in 70+ countries with the insights and resources to build a competitive business plan for their careers. Plus, we connect you to a global team of expert career advisors for one-on-one support when you need it. A BlueSteps membership equips you with career intel and opportunities you can’t get anywhere else—straight from the world’s leading executive search firms."

2. School of Business Alumni Page:

http://alumni.business.wfu.edu/

'Staying Connected' pull down has information on Regional Chapters and Activities under 'Wake Communities'. Wake Communities contains information on Wake Forest Clubs nationwide by geography and special interest (i.e., Wake on Wall Street Group). Please note the Alumni Directory Search Tool known as 'Wake Network'.

'Grow Your Career' pull down contains 'Job Search' section with info on Alumni LinkedIn Group(s) for School of Business with LinkedIn user tips.

Handshake, Career Shift, and Goin Global search tools are accessible with alumni email accounts. https://business.wfu.edu/alumni/job-search/

3. WFU Alumni LinkedIn:

https://www.linkedin.com/groups/95941/jobs

Among those who post jobs on this page are representatives from the Employer Relations Groups at the School of Business and the Undergraduate Office of Career and Personal Development. Generally, these leads come from either human resource contacts or alumni who are interested in sourcing the talent of WFU alumni.
